Everything I've seen about hydrogen says its a net-negative. You need to put in a large amount of energy to create and store the hydrogen.
I think the central-planners' notion is - you have solar and wind which have strong peaks and troughs of energy production. What do you do with the extra energy produced on warm, sunny days by wind and solar? you send that power to make hydrogen, where it can be (in theory) stored for use later, when the sun isn't shining, and the wind isn't blowing.
